Jagan Mohan Reddy undergoes treatment

He was admitted to Nizams Institute of Medical Sciences.

YSR Congress president Y S Jagan Mohan Reddy is undergoing treatment at a hospital here where he was admitted late Wednesday night following a five-day fast in support of united Andhra Pradesh. Police had last night evicted Reddy from his Lotus Pond home in posh Jubilee Hills area as doctors voiced concern over his deteriorating health. He was admitted to Nizams Institute of Medical Sciences.

YSR Congress leaders said Jagan is likely to remain in the hospital for the day as his condition deteriorated due to the fast. His family members visited him in the hospital on Thursday.
